David R. Leighton
1969 - 2005
David R. Leighton, 36, of Cromwell died Thursday, (October 20, 2005) after 14 years
struggling with Gulf War Illness.
Born October 2, 1969 in Middletown, son of Brian and Gail (Young) Leighton, Sr. of Naugatuck. He was
a life long resident of Cromwell. He was a carpenter before serving in the U.S. Marine Corps. during
the Gulf War. After the war he was employed by New England Health and Racquet. David was always an avid
outdoorsmen.
Besides his parents he is survived by his fiancé Anna Dubik of Cromwell; two brothers, Brian Leighton,
Jr. and his wife, Becky and their children, Mackenzie and Brian of Naugatuck, and Lloyd Martin of
Phoenix, AZ; two grandmothers, Gladys Martin of Lathrup, CA, Velma Leighton of Killingworth and a host
of other relatives and friends. He leaves his beloved pet “Roxie”.
